MARYVILLE -- A strong second-half performance from the Maryville Scots gave them a 2-0 victory over CCSÂ opponent Covenant. The win keeps them atop the conference at 4-0-1 with three matches remaining.

Both teams were evenly matched in the first half, with the score remaining tied 0-0, neither team gaining an advantage or capitalizing on their limited opportunities. Maryville outshot covenant 7-4 during the first 45 minutes of play.

Just five minutes into the second half,
Hannah Smoot was able to capitalize on a through ball from
Hailey Cartt. Smoot lofted the ball just over the reach of the goalkeeper to give Maryville a 1-0 lead in the 51st minute.

The Scots weren't done there, extending their lead in the 66th minute off the right foot of
Katie O'Brien. The powerful shot from 18 yards out was O'Brien's seventh goal of the season, tying her with
Sierra Lee for the team lead in that category.
Chloe Chase recorded her second assist of the season on the play.

In the second half, Maryville outshot Covenant 11-2, giving them an 18-6 edge in shots for the game. Twelve of those Maryville shots were on target.

Goalkeeper
Sophie Turner recorded five saves and picked up her fifth shutout of the year and her first since Sept. 22 against Belhaven.

The Scots play again on Saturday, traveling to Demorest, Georgia, for a CCS matchup against Piedmont. Maryville is looking to even the score after losing to the Lions twice last season.
